仕様
| Package | Tape & Reel (TR),Cut Tape (CT),Bulk |
| ProductStatus | Active |
| OutputConfiguration | Positive |
| OutputType | Fixed |
| NumberofRegulators | 2 |
| Voltage-Input(Max) | 5.5V |
| Voltage-Output(Min/Fixed) | 3.3V, 1.8V |
| VoltageDropout(Max) | 0.2V @ 200mA, - |
| Current-Output | 200mA |
| Current-Quiescent(Iq) | 110 µA |
| PSRR | 80dB ~ 50dB (10Hz ~ 100kHz) |
| ControlFeatures | Enable |
| ProtectionFeatures | Over Current, Over Temperature, Short Circuit, Under Voltage Lockout (UVLO) |
| OperatingTemperature | -40°C ~ 125°C (TJ) |
| MountingType | Surface Mount |
| Package/Case | 6-WFDFN |
